Star Wars: Did The Mandalorian Trailer Tease The Return Of Jabba The Hutt?


The first official trailer for The Mandalorian certainly has everyone excited for what appears to be a Western set in the Star Wars Universe but it may have also teased on the return of an iconic villain. Did the teaser just hint at Jabba the Hutt showing up in the Disney+ series?

It's certainly cool how the trailer didn't reveal too much about the main storyline but it did show us just enough to get us interested. For instance, it confirmed that the Deathtroopers will have a presence in The Mandalorian. In addition to that, we got to see the droid IG-11 in action, spinning around and shooting away with glorious abandon. But then again, there were two shots that seemed to tease that a huge villain is coming.

There's a brief shot of a female Twi'lek looking back and winking at an unseen character. There's a possibility that she's bidding the titular Mandalorian a cheeky goodbye, but is she also proof that Jabba is part of the storyline? After all, the crime lord was associated with Bib Fortuna and another female Twi'lek in the original Star Wars trilogy. On the other hand, this particular Twi'lek might have nothing to do with Jabba at all.

The second clue comes later in the trailer when an unfortunate alien is shown trapped in carbonite. You might remember that Jabba's favorite artwork was Han Solo encased in carbonite so could this be another piece of art that the Hutt had commissioned?

Although we're really hoping we haven't seen the last of Jabba just yet, it's important to point out that The Mandalorian takes place after the fall of the Empire. Since Jabba was already dead by then (thanks, Leia), it's unlikely that he will show up in the series. However, we shouldn't rule out the possibility that there will be a reference to Jabba or the Hutts in the show.

The Mandalorian will premiere on Disney+ on November 12.
